Amazon Senior Customer Solutions Manager in Singapore, Singapore

Description

Amazon Web Services, an Amazon.com Company, has been the world’s leading cloud provider for more than 17 years with the most mature, comprehensive, and broadly adopted cloud platform. We have over 200 fully featured cloud services, managed from 99 availability zones within 31 geographic regions across the globe. Millions of customers in over 240 countries - from the fastest growing start-ups to the largest enterprises, through to leading government agencies - all place their trust in Amazon Web Services to power their infrastructure, and deliver innovation.

AWS Sales, Marketing, and Global Services (SMGS) is responsible for driving revenue, adoption, and growth from the largest and fastest growing small- and mid-market accounts to enterprise-level customers including public sector. The AWS Global Support team interacts with leading companies and believes that world-class support is critical to customer success. AWS Support also partners with a global list of customers that are building mission-critical applications on top of AWS services.

Key job responsibilities

• You will be an AWS evangelist and influence your customers to allocate the appropriate resources to achieve their goals

• Your technical expertise and operational excellence will influence your team’s decisions and help us drive secure and robust customer solutions

• You will be responsible leading complex, large scale, IT/technical/engineering programs, and drive cross-team(WW included) communication and solution building

• You will also possess customer facing skills, and strong capability communicating in both English and Mandarin, that will allow you to represent Amazon well within targeted customers' environment

• You will need to assess risks, anticipate bottlenecks, provide critical issue management, balance trade-offs, and encourage risk-tasking to maximize business value

Basic Qualifications

  • 7+ years of leading large-scale, technical or engineering programs with a proven record of thought leadership, business case development, realizing customer benefits, and successful program completion experience

  • 5+ years of customer-facing work, engaging with customer executives, technologists or partners to solve business problems with advanced technologies experience

  • Bachelor's degree in science, technology, engineering, math, business or equivalent

  • Experience leading technical and non-technical transformation project teams with a proven ability to work across broad functional teams

  • Strong written and verbal communication skill in English and Mandarin

Preferred Qualifications

  • PMP certification, or SCRUM/Agile, SAFe certification

  • Experience implementing cloud services including migrations and modernization projects or similar

  • Direct experience implementing AWS/cloud services

  • Strong listening skills; demonstrated ability to ask effective questions
